Technical Specifications
Side-by-side comparison of Xeon W-2245 and Xeon Gold 6137

Xeon W-2245
The Xeon W-2245 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 2015-01-01. It features 8 cores and 16 threads. Base frequency is 3.9 GHz, with boost up to 4.7 GHz. L3 cache: 16.5 MB. Built on 14 nm process technology. Socket: LGA2066. Thermal design power (TDP): 155 Watt. Memory support: DDR4-2933. Passmark benchmark score: 19,422 points. Launch price was $800.

Xeon Gold 6137
The Xeon Gold 6137 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 2015-01-01. It features 8 cores and 16 threads. Base frequency is 3.9 GHz, with boost up to 4.1 GHz. L3 cache: 25 MB. Built on 14 nm process technology. Socket: LGA3647. Thermal design power (TDP): 205 Watt. Memory support: DDR4-2666. Passmark benchmark score: 19,365 points. Launch price was $800.
Processing Power
Both the Xeon W-2245 and Xeon Gold 6137 share an identical 8-core/16-thread configuration. Boost clocks reach 4.7 GHz on the Xeon W-2245 versus 4.1 GHz on the Xeon Gold 6137 — a 13.6% clock advantage for the Xeon W-2245 (base: 3.9 GHz vs 3.9 GHz). In PassMark, the Xeon W-2245 scores 19,422 against the Xeon Gold 6137's 19,365 — a 0.3% lead for the Xeon W-2245. L3 cache: 16.5 MB on the Xeon W-2245 vs 25 MB on the Xeon Gold 6137.
| Feature | Xeon W-2245 | Xeon Gold 6137 |
|---|---|---|
| Cores / Threads | 8 / 16 | 8 / 16 |
| Boost Clock | 4.7 GHz+15% | 4.1 GHz |
| Base Clock | 3.9 GHz | 3.9 GHz |
| L3 Cache | 16.5 MB | 25 MB+52% |
| Process | 14 nm | 14 nm |
| PassMark | 19,422 | 19,365 |
